Court has sentenced three Oyo School Kidnap suspects to life imprisonment for terrorism links.

 

NewsOnline Nigeria reports that three men standing trial over the kidnapping of pupils and teachers in Oriire Local Government Area of Oyo State have been sentenced to life imprisonment by the Federal High Court in Abuja.

 

Justice Salim Ibrahim handed the life sentences to Abdulrazak Umar, also known as Abu Khalifa/Abu Khalid; Yunusa Musa, also known as Yunusa Bin Musa; and Shamsu Adamu Sani, also known as Abu Itisar, after they admitted to being members of a proscribed terrorist group.

The Department of State Services (DSS) had arraigned the trio on a 10-count charge bordering on terrorism, kidnapping, concealment of terrorist activities, incitement and other related offences linked to the abduction of schoolchildren and teachers in Oyo State.

 

Although the defendants were initially charged on 10 counts, they pleaded guilty to counts 4 and 6, among others, admitting to concealing information about the activities of the terrorists responsible for the school abduction.

 

Delivering judgment, Justice Ibrahim convicted the three defendants and sentenced each of them to life imprisonment for concealing knowledge of the terrorists’ operations and for their association with the proscribed group.

 

The case stems from the mass abduction of pupils and teachers in Oriire Local Government Area, one of the most high-profile school kidnapping incidents in the country.
